Our Contributors

Vicki Mullins

Vicki has passionately worked in the interior design education training and assessment sector for over ten years.

As the head tutor at IDI, Vicki has a wealth of knowledge and now leads our education team, in addition to hosting various online workshops for our students.

She is a people-orientated leader and mentor with a keen interest in empowering students to reach their full potential and become future designers.

Wendi Snyder

For over a decade, Wendi has supported students on their interior design journey at IDI.

Before commencing her career in interior design, Wendi had a twenty-five-year career in theatre, working in costume and set design, which took her all around the world and developed her love for interior design.

Wendi is passionate about education and finds it rewarding to pass on her extensive knowledge to her students.

Jasmine Abel

Jasmine brings over ten years of experience in interior design and the online learning industry. She is the facilitator of our online workshops, manages our social platforms and beautifies our course curriculum.

Jasmine draws on her extensive experience and knowledge to create and drive change by energising and influencing students.

She is passionate about the world of interiors, living mindfully and providing wholesome learning experiences.

Linda Bistricic

Linda has over twenty years of experience teaching interior design and working in the industry.

In addition to being a freelance artist, Linda has been a guest presenter since 2017 and is a member of the Design Institute of Australia and the National Association for the Visual Arts.

She is a passionate design educator known for her empathetic mentoring style and specialises in teaching design fundamentals and methodology, colour and drawing.

Rebecca Gross

Rebecca Gross is a design historian, freelance researcher, and writer specialising in design, architecture and visual culture.

She studies cultural history through the lens of architecture and design and holds a Masters in the History of Decorative Arts and Design and a Bachelors in Marketing.

Rebecca has more than fifteen years of experience in the industry and is a certified Professional Historian (Associate) accredited by the Professional Historians Association Inc.

Wende Reid

Under her company name, form and colour, Wende Reid practices architectural, interior and furniture design and fine art consulting. She began her career in New York and now practices in Sydney.

She has been awarded twice for excellence in her designs. During her career, she has held licensing agreements in the US and Europe, under her own trademark and for clients.

She has developed numerous best-selling collections in decorative textiles, wallpaper, bed linen, rugs, lighting, dinnerware and flatware.
